Fundamental Kinetic Study of Slag Metal Gas ReactionsThe current project will determine fundamental properties important in metal refining. In particular, properties that can be used in mathematical models to help optimize steelmaking processes. The work will impact practical steelmaking and the scientific community. The data will also be useful in the design of carbon free electrochemical steelmaking processes.Metallurgical slag is seen by the lay-person as a waste from the process and is considered unsightly and undesirable. However to the metallurgist it is an important reagent used to refine the metal. This is particularly true in steelmaking where slag is used to remove sulphur, phosphorus and other elements, from the metal. Slag may also supply oxygen to the metal which in the case of desulphurization is a bad thing but in the case of dephosphorisation is good. The balance between the rate of oxygen supply from the slag and consumption by reactive elements in the metal is important in setting the so called "dynamic oxygen potential" at the slag/metal interface. It is not possible to measure the dynamic oxygen potential and in most cases it cannot be calculated directly. In our laboratory we have recently proposed method by which it can be determined but, without more information on the rate of oxygen transfer, we still do not have a comprehensive picture.The proposed research is intended to measure transfer rates of oxygen for a wide range of slags and conditions and to compare these with measurements of electronic conductivity(also known to assist oxygen transfer). These measurements combined with measurements of oxygen transfer by the method recently employed in our lab, will offer us the ability to create better models of processes.The conductivity measurements are also important for our fundamental understanding. A mechanism for electronic conduction was identified in our lab for slags containing iron oxide. This mechanism, known as diffusion assisted hopping, was recently shown by workers in my lab to work for slags containing manganese. The current research will investigate whether this mechanism works for a range of different slag types.
